Mechanical insufflationexsufflation is a therapy in which the device the coughassist inexsufflator is the only currently marketed insufflationexsufflation device gradually inflates the lungs insufflation, followed by an immediate and abrupt change to negative pressure, which produces a rapid exhalation exsufflation, which simulates a. The usage of mechanical insufflationexsufflation devices douglas li, md, and the cts pediatric committee mechanism of action in order to effectively cough, a patient is required to inspire to near lung capacity 8090%, close the glottis, and subsequently open the glottis in concert with accessory expiratory muscle contraction. The cough assist helps to clear secretions by applying a positive pressure to fill the lungs, then quickly switching to a negative pressure to produce a high expiratory flow rate and simulate a cough.
